JS验证控制输入中英文字节长度(input、textarea等)具体实例
检查表单是否符合规定的长度.最长允许n个字符(中文算2位)!
代码如下:
function fucCheckLength(strTemp) {
var i,sum;
sum=0;
for(i=0;i<strTemp.length;i++) {
if ((strTemp.charCodeAt(i)>=0) && (strTemp.charCodeAt(i)<=255)) {
sum=sum+1;
}else {
sum=sum+2;
}
}
return sum;
}
m=fucCheckLength(strTemp);
if(m>10){
alert("长度大于10个字符!");
}
相关推荐
-
JS input 数字验证代码
/* **@控制控件只能输入数字,含-(负号).(小数点) **@Inline HTML: <ELEMENT ... onkeypress="javascript:onlyNumber()" style="ime-mode:disabled"> For Input **@Event property: object.attachEvent("onkeypress",onlyNumber);object.style.imeMode =
-
JS验证input输入框(字母,数字,符号,中文)
只能输入英文 <input type="text" onkeyup="value=value.replace(/[^a-zA-Z]/g,'')"> 只能输入英文 <input type="text" onkeyup="value=value.replace(/[^\a-\z\A-\Z]/g,'')" onkeydown="fncKeyStop(event)" onpaste="r
-
JS验证控制输入中英文字节长度(input、textarea等)具体实例
检查表单是否符合规定的长度.最长允许n个字符(中文算2位)! 复制代码 代码如下: function fucCheckLength(strTemp) { var i,sum; sum=0; for(i=0;i<strTemp.length;i++) { if ((strTemp.charCodeAt(i)>=0) && (strTemp.charCodeAt(i)<=255)) { sum=sum+1; }else { sum=
-
JS验证 只能输入小数点,数字,负数的实现方法
如下所示: <script language="JavaScript" type="text/javascript"> function clearNoNum(event, obj) { //响应鼠标事件,允许左右方向键移动 event = window.event || event; if (event.keyCode == 37 | event.keyCode == 39) { return; } var t = obj.value.charAt(0
-
javascript验证内容为数字以及长度为10的简单实例
javascript验证内容为数字以及长度为10的简单实例 <html> <head> <script type="text/javascript"> function valid() { var numVal = document.getElementById("num").value; if(numVal!=undefined&&numVal!=""){ if(!validateNum(nu
-
JS验证图片格式和大小并预览的简单实例
实例如下: function photoCheck(obj){ var ff = $("#photoSrc").val(); if(ff == null || ff == ""){ return; } photo_flag = true; var fSize = 50.9 * 1024; var fileType; var fileSize; var filePath; if (obj.files) { // webkit, mozilla... (jq:$.sup
-
textarea 控制输入字符字节数(示例代码)
按字符数控制: 复制代码 代码如下: <textarea name="gbContent" style="width: 500px; height: 200px;" onkeyup="if(this.value.length>2000) this.value=this.value.substr(0,2000)" onkeydown="if(this.value.length&
-
JS验证输入的是否是数字及保留几位小数问题
1.验证方法 validationNumber(e, num) e代表标签对象,num代表保留小数位数 function validationNumber(e, num) { var regu = /^[0-9]+\.?[0-9]*$/; if (e.value != "") { if (!regu.test(e.value)) { alert("请输入正确的数字"); e.value = e.value.substring(0, e.value.length -
-
收藏的js表单验证控制代码大全第1/3页
关键字:js验证表单大全,用JS控制表单提交 ,javascript提交表单: 目录: 1:js 字符串长度限制.判断字符长度 .js限制输入.限制不能输入.textarea 长度限制 2.:js判断汉字.判断是否汉字 .只能输入汉字 3:js判断是否输入英文.只能输入英文 4:js只能输入数字,判断数字.验证数字.检测数字.判断是否为数字.只能输入数字 5:只能输入英文字符和数字 6: js email验证 .js 判断email .信箱/邮箱格式验证 7:js字符过滤,屏蔽关键字 8:js
-
解析使用js判断只能输入数字、字母等验证的方法(总结)
JS判断只能是数字和小数点0.不能输入中文1)<input onpaste="return false;" type="text" name="textfield" style="width:400px; ime-mode:disabled" value="">2)<script>function chkIt(frm){if (frm.n1.value.length>0&
-
CutePsWheel javascript libary 控制输入文本框为可使用滚轮控制的js库
简介 实现类似于Photoshop控制面板输入文本数字的效果,所以名称叫做PsWheel.用于控制输入数字类型文本框实现鼠标滚轮上下滑动改变值,支持正整数.小数类型输入文本. 兼容IE/Firefox/Opera/Safari/Chrom 可定义滚动变化间隔值,支持整数.浮点数 双击恢复初始值 仅3.92K,压缩后2.67K 代码 复制代码 代码如下: /* * cutePsWheel JS * Description:A js liabary which control the text ty
-
js实现控制textarea输入字符串的个数,鼠标按下抬起判断输入字符数
[Html代码] <table> <tr> <td width="150">短信内容:</td> <td> <textarea name="message" cols="96" rows="5" onKeyDown="textCounter(message,remLen,65);" onKeyUp="textCounter(mess
随机推荐
- 手机端页面rem宽度自适应脚本
- iOS 屏幕解锁文字动画效果
- Android仿微信图片点击全屏效果
- Vue中计算属性computed的示例解读
- MVC4制作网站教程第二章 用户登陆2.2
- C#/.Net 中快速批量给SQLite数据库插入测试数据
- jquery html5 视频播放控制代码
- 模仿百度三维地图的js数据分享
- 微信小程序报错:this.setData is not a function的解决办法
- nginx配置ssl双向验证的方法
- Springboot整合log4j2日志全解总结
- Java 中 Date 与 Calendar 之间的编辑与转换实例详解
- python开头的coding设置方法
- node-red File读取好保存实例讲解
- 关于spring版本与JDK版本不兼容的问题及解决方法
- 解决微信小程序中转换时间格式IOS不兼容的问题
- JavaScript实现创建自定义对象的常用方式总结
- webpack4 SCSS提取和懒加载的示例
- vue项目中监听手机物理返回键的实现
- python 中的[:-1]和[::-1]的具体使用
